Output 26515b005705c50e1be71cf9603ce628b38e53901caf65d3f4ec3b08d009bb2e:0

value
940500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e5a73bcfccae6f184532000bebea7296a7caca9 OP_EQUAL
address
3QsuuzRmfhk6BZxvP9dqKYyk9iHv4mY5Gg
transaction
26515b005705c50e1be71cf9603ce628b38e53901caf65d3f4ec3b08d009bb2e
spent
true